In the model of Expansive Nondecelerative Universe, black hole cannot totally
evaporate via quantum evaporation process proposed by Hawking. In a limiting
case, an equilibrium of gravitation creation and black hole evaporation can be
reached keeping the surface of its horizon constant. This conclusion is in
accordance with the second law of thermodynamics.
